Output 7fbb5abb04a942bda8a75789d16f7ab38a1afd7b7af8b5bfcfaae5236c0669c3:0

value
2347611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3666995e650b7b051dcfe4d307708d0d9c66e2f OP_EQUAL
address
3LxoBm7FmgegFTXGaoX4uqogx1o6y97Bp7
transaction
7fbb5abb04a942bda8a75789d16f7ab38a1afd7b7af8b5bfcfaae5236c0669c3
spent
true